The overview
Logan Square is built around its namesake historic boulevards and the illuminated Centennial Monument, with one of the city's best food-and-drink scenes radiating from the square. Breweries, cocktail bars, and destination restaurants sit among greystones and classic two-flats.
For renters it's character and value: more space for the money than the north lakefront, a strong sense of community, and the Blue Line and the 606 trail for getting around — the trade-off being a longer ride downtown.
What you’ll love
A nationally recognized restaurant, bar, and craft-beer scene around the square.
Lula Cafe, 2537 N Kedzie Blvd · Longman & Eagle, 2657 N Kedzie Ave · Revolution Brewing, 2323 N Milwaukee Ave
The elevated 606 trail and the landmarked boulevard system for green space.
The 606 / Bloomingdale Trail · Logan Square boulevards · Palmer Square Park
